Avoid Fraud When Buying On Craigslist

Here are my thoughts about avoid fraud when buying on Craigslist

Craigslist is an online classified site which has seen an increase in popularity in recent years. Millions of Americans have realized the profit potential to make money on Craigslist selling their products undesirable. What does this mean for you as a buyer? It means that our special offers. Unfortunately, it must be always on the lookout for fraud. Appear all over the Internet scams, including Craigslist.org. How can you protect yourself?

Being aware of common Craigslist Scams

The best way to avoid scams on Craigslist, is knowing what to look for. Buy As for those using on-line, such as clothing, toys, movies and books, including payments by cable. This is usually a clear sign of a scam. Craigslist is designed to connect local buyers and sellers in touch. Buyers usually choose their purchases and a cash payment. Be careful set of sellers who are dead against it.

Use Your Best Case

The easiest way to avoid scams on Craigslist, use the best decision. Of course, you are looking for the best offer, but is looking for offers that seem too good to be true. Many people mistakenly believe fraudsters is the highest price for a product to be free. This is not always true. A fraudster offering to sell an iPhone to sell the phone for only $ 25, because they know they have no product and does not intend to sell them. They also know that buyers are likely to get more than $ 25. With a lower price, buyers are more likely to fall victim to fraudsters, which means more money for fraud in the long term.

Avoid Job Scams With Craigslist

Here are my thoughts on how to avoid job scams with Craigslist.

Looking for a new job? If you want to change career paths or the victim of a layoff, Craigslist.org is a valuable research tool. This site has thousands of online classified ads for jobs, many of whom could be the perfect candidate for. Unfortunately, Internet fraud is on online jobs. You can find some of these scams on Craigslist, but there are steps you can take to avoid them.

Knowing what kind of job you are looking for Craigslist scams. In terms of jobs, most scams are focused on the acquisition of personal information or to get money from you. This money is often in the form of a "required" to pay in advance. Always remember that you should be paid to work, not vice versa. If background checks or training material required for employment, the employer must be responsible for all necessary expenses, not you. As for your personal information, will not divulge account information or Social Security number until they have had a job interview and are employed.

Always use your best judgment. If you are looking for a job locally, fraud will be easier to locate. We are familiar with local businesses. If they try to move to a new job or finding a job working from home, use your best judgment. Opportunity that sounds too good to be true, it is very likely. To say that he worked as a secretary full time and earned $ 35,000 a year. Beware of employment offers that demand may work in the same place, perform the same tasks, but that $ 100,000 per year. Something does not sound right and can then be in the middle of a job scam. Before handing over personal information, always searching.
